P/E Ratio Analysis
As of June 22, 2026, Vista Energy, S.A.B. de C.V. (VIST) trades at a price-to-earnings ratio of 10.2x, with a stock price of $68.55 and trailing twelve-month earnings per share of $6.75.
The current P/E is 92% below its 5-year average of 133.8x. Over the past five years, VIST's P/E has ranged from a low of 4.0x to a high of 2515.0x, placing the current valuation at the 70th percentile of its historical range.
Compared to the Energy sector median P/E of 15.4x, VIST trades at a 34% discount to its sector peers. The sector includes 174 companies with P/E ratios ranging from 0.5x to 166.4x.
Relative to the broader market, VIST trades at a notable discount to the S&P 500 median P/E of 24.4x. Investors should consider the company's growth prospects, competitive position, and earnings quality when evaluating whether the current valuation is justified.
